Initial Setup and Calibration

Before starting, make sure your workspace is clean, well-ventilated, and free from dust. Power on your Qidi X-Plus 3 2026 and follow these calibration steps:

Level the Print Bed

Proper bed leveling is crucial for print adhesion and quality. Use the auto-leveling feature if available, or manually adjust the bed screws to ensure the nozzle is evenly distanced across the entire surface.

Check and Replace Nozzle

Inspect the nozzle for wear or clogs. Replace it if necessary to maintain precise extrusion. Use high-quality replacement nozzles compatible with your filament type.

Firmware and Software Configuration

Keep your firmware updated to the latest version for improved performance and new features. Connect your printer to the Qidi Print software or compatible slicer and configure the following:

  • Set the correct print bed temperature based on filament type.
  • Adjust the extruder temperature for optimal filament flow.
  • Configure print speeds for different layers and details.
  • Enable or disable features like filament run-out detection.

Material Selection and Preparation

Choose high-quality filament suitable for your projects. Store filament properly to prevent moisture absorption, which can affect print quality. Before printing, load the filament correctly and ensure it extrudes smoothly.

Advanced Printing Tips

For best performance in 2026, experiment with the following:

  • Use a heated enclosure to maintain stable temperatures and reduce warping.
  • Apply adhesive aids like glue stick or painter’s tape for better bed adhesion.
  • Enable cooling fans for detailed prints to improve surface finish.
  • Calibrate the extruder steps regularly for consistent extrusion.

Maintenance and Troubleshooting

Regular maintenance ensures longevity and performance. Clean the print bed, nozzle, and extruder assembly periodically. Check belts and pulleys for tightness and wear. Replace worn parts promptly.

If issues arise, consult the user manual or online support forums. Common problems include filament jams, layer shifting, or adhesion failures. Troubleshoot systematically to identify and resolve the root cause.
